Test plan: pool exhaustion, Querrel DB layer. Cases: (1) saturate pool at max=20, assert queue wait metrics emit; (2) kill idle connections, verify reaper reclaims within 60s; (3) failover to replica mid-transaction, expect clean rollback. Run against the Ostvale staging cluster only. Harness needs an authenticated session for the metrics endpoint; all requests must carry the staging bearer token, which is provided below.

portal login ticket: eyJhbGciOiJIUzI1NiIsInR5cCI6IkpXVCJ9.eyJzdWIiOiIwEOsktwVNwIn0.-UJU3fdyyCgG

Leadership Review Briefing — Loyalty Programme Overhaul

For the incoming director: the Silverbranch Rewards scheme will be replaced next quarter with a tiered points model developed by the Customer Office in Ferndale. Migration of existing members is automated; redemption rates are projected to rise modestly. Budget is approved. The confidential commercial rationale is set out below.

management briefing: Project Ulavan slips by two quarters because of the staffing delay.

# Quotaville Environments

Quick refresher for whoever's on call: Quotaville enforces per-tenant rate quotas differently in staging and prod. Staging is deliberately loose so partner teams can hammer it; prod clamps down hard and will shed traffic without apology. Before you bump anything for a noisy tenant, check the current prod values first.

service settings:
[casax]
port = 6379
team = rusir
host = casax.zemvarhq.corp
region = outer-4
access_code = ac_9808ce
timeout_ms = 1500